LED Grow Lights: How Do They Work?

Light Emitting Diode (LED) is a small electronic component that is constructed of two types of semiconductors. This includes holes that have a positive charge and electrons, the ones with a negative charge.

When an LED is supplied with the proper voltage, it causes the electric current to flow which then makes the holes and electrons collide. The collision between the two elements generates energy in the form of light quanta, photons. This process is called recombination.

Older LED lights had a limited selection of colors and low light output. However, things have changed today as modern LEDs are available in a variety of colors in visible ultraviolet and infrared spectral ranges. Not just that, but they are also much brighter than their older counterparts.

You can use LED grow lights for all types of indoor plants. To get the best results, you must use full-spectrum LED lights as they help plants to photosynthesize. Out of all the colors in the spectrum, the blue and red color matters the most. Just so you know the blue part of the spectrum promotes leaf growth, while the red part helps in growing fruit and flower.
